Objective
To train participants to conduct fit tests provided for in the Respiratory Protection Program, by presenting the different methods and protocols available.
Course content
1. Definitions;
2. Selection of the appropriate respirator for the exposure and the user;
3. Inspection of respirators and ability to identify those with poor maintenance;
4. Correct placement of the mask to cover the airways;
5. Seal checking;
6. Purpose and applicability of qualitative and quantitative fit tests;
7. Purpose of the protocol exercises;
8. Preparation of facial parts to being tested;
9. Checking facial parts and test equipment;
10. Capacity and limitations of test equipment;
11. Correct conduct of the test following the chosen method;
12. Problems that may arise during the test;
13. Interpretation of the test results;
14. Information that must be recorded.
